Project Overview

In 2024, Iowa Speedway underwent a significant partial repave project in preparation for hosting its first-ever NASCAR Cup Series event.

As the lead contractors, our team was responsible for executing this high-profile upgrade to the 0.875-mile oval in Newton, Iowa.

The project focused on repaving the bottom two lanes of all four corners, while the straightaways retained their original pavement from 2006. This approach balanced the need for improved racing conditions with preserving the track’s unique character. The fresh asphalt provided smoother grip and enhanced durability, while still allowing drivers to experience the worn, challenging surface on the straights.

Outcomes & Results:

Scope of Work: Partial resurfacing of the corners, specifically the lower lanes, to improve safety and performance.
Purpose: To prepare the track for NASCAR’s inaugural Cup Series race in June 2024, as well as the NTT IndyCar Series event later that summer.
Impact on Racing: The repave introduced new variables for teams and drivers, creating fresh racing lines and strategic challenges. NASCAR and IndyCar officials confirmed the surface met all performance and safety standards.
Reception: While some drivers initially expressed concern about the “split surface,” the repave ultimately delivered competitive racing and showcased Iowa Speedway as a premier venue for national series.
